1. Classic Micro Braids

Classic micro braids bring timeless elegance that never goes out of style. The tiny uniform braids run in neat rows down your scalp, creating a smooth, polished finish that instantly highlights your facial features and bone structure. The clean lines give a sophisticated look that photographs beautifully from every angle while staying light and comfortable all day long.
In my experience, classic micro braids are perfect for first-timers because they require almost zero daily styling once installed. They last six to eight weeks with proper care and work equally well with office blouses or weekend casual wear. 7. Knotless Micro Braids

Knotless micro braids offer a smoother, gentler install with less tension at the scalp while keeping the same delicate look. The seamless start makes them feel lighter and more natural from day one. The braids flow beautifully and reduce breakage risk for healthier hair underneath.
This micro braid style has become a favorite for sensitive scalps. I’ve noticed clients report less discomfort and longer wear time compared to traditional methods. It still delivers stunning definition and texture but with extra comfort that makes daily life easier.

12. Feed-In Micro Braids

Feed-in micro braids use a seamless technique that adds hair gradually for a natural, painless start at the scalp. The tiny braids look incredibly smooth and realistic from the roots, creating a flawless finish that blends beautifully with your own hair. This method reduces tension and gives a lighter, more comfortable feel from day one.
I’ve tried feed-in micro braids and loved how gentle they feel compared to traditional methods. They last just as long while protecting your edges better. Perfect for busy women who want stunning micro braid styles without scalp soreness or heavy maintenance.
